SHE Media's Business of Influence Survey Reveals That 96% of Bloggers and Social Influencers Are Building Their Business on Instagram
SHE
Media, formerly SheKnows Media, is a mission-driven digital
media company created for and by women with approximately 60 million
unique visitors per month (comScore (News - Alert)) and 350 million-plus social media
fans and followers. Today, the company debuted its new name, SHE Media,
along with a bold new logo and expanded company mission statement -
underscoring its commitment to validating women's voices and leadership
as a unifying force for good, and to creating a sustainable economic
model for women entrepreneurs and small businesses through its SHE
Media Partner Network.
In addition, SHE Media revealed results from its new Business of
Influence Survey of 300 bloggers and social media influencers - the
majority of which are women and are affiliated with the SHE Media
Partner Network. When asked about the biggest challenge content creators
like themselves face, the most common response was the need for more and
greater earning opportunities through brand partnerships.

Another key aspect of the SHE Media Partner Network is its focus on
midsized specialty influencers with highly engaged, loyal audiences.
Half of the content creators who took the Business of Influence survey
indicated that their total social reach ranges from 10,000 to up to
50,000 followers.
Skey added, "It's often the midsized, specialty bloggers and social
media influencers who provide greater efficiency for advertisers. An
endorsement from a large-scale household name influencer is an important
part of the mix too, but midsized content creators are likely to have
greater depth within the specific vertical or demo a brand is pursuing,
as well as higher rates of engagement due to loyal, niche audiences.
When implemented at scale, this model delivers strong ROI for brands
that view engagement as their core influencer marketing KPI."
Additional findings from SHE edia's Business of Influence survey
include:
-
Two-thirds, or 60%, of influencers have been creating digital
content to build an audience and/or brand between one and six years;
nearly 27% have been doing so from seven to 10 or more years.
This is significant because it shows that just 13% are new to
their craft, and the majority are now leaning on the SHE Media Partner
Network to help them take their business to the next level in terms of
brand collaboration and monetization.
-
About 90% of survey respondents indicated their interest in
paid sponsorships and branded content opportunities, with 55%
participating in these programs regularly; and 84% said they
currently run ads on their blog or website, or plan to.
-
More than 96% create content on Instagram - the platform du
jour for influencers and the most effective for brands with more than
600 million monthly users, according to Adweek.
-
Nearly half (48%) create new content one or more times per day,
a volume that indicates today's influencer is truly a media company of
one. The top five categories they cover (in order of frequency)
include: Health & Wellness, Food, Travel, Parenting & Family, and
Beauty & Fashion.
-
94% are always looking for tools and resources to better manage
their business, 91% are looking for guidance on how to take
their brand to the next level, 66% have established an LLC (or
equivalent) for their business, and 47% have a business plan
and marketing strategy for growing their brand. 20% even have
paid employees.
-
Most influencers handle their own social media posts, copy
writing/editing, marketing/PR, photography, and finance/accounting.
They work with partners on design, website development/coding, video
recording/editing, brand partnerships and ad inventory.
-
96% of survey respondents feel it is important to use their
influence for social good, and 92% feel it is important to work
with brands that support women content creators and entrepreneurs.

The rebrand marks another milestone in the company's evolution. In March
2018, Penske Media Corporation (PMC) announced its acquisition of SHE
Media. In July 2018, Skey became the first female CEO in the company's
history.
